Transaction 90450e25381d5f26da46101c831ee3ac0248e656907b878176d9855d6e7d3666
1 Input
1 Output
-
90450e25381d5f26da46101c831ee3ac0248e656907b878176d9855d6e7d3666:0
- value
- 2441497
- script pubkey
- OP_0 OP_PUSHBYTES_20 bf77ea90fad4ef8b184e16d5db4c85c7903ae4dc
- address
- bc1qham74y866nhckxzwzm2akny9c7gr4exuk4l4jv